AI and Pricing: What AI Does Well (and What It Won't Do for You)

__wf_reserved_inherit

Before jumping in, it’s important to distinguish between the machine’s superpowers and the responsibilities that remain purely human, in order to avoid AI pricing errors.

What AI Actually Improves

AI excels at detecting weak signals and synthesizing large amounts of data. It simulates complex scenarios in record time to inform decision-making.

It automates repetitive tasks. This frees up time for strategic analysis.

What AI Can't Replace

Pure strategy and political maneuvering remain the exclusive domain of humans. AI also cannot handle the subtleties of business relationships or overall corporate governance.

The long-term vision is human. Machines lack business intuition.

Requirements for reliable use

Without its own data and clear guidelines, the tool becomes dangerous. Strict validation processes must be established to oversee each algorithmic recommendation before it is implemented.

Data quality is the foundation. There are no shortcuts to success.

Mistake #1 — Confusing AI with pricing strategy

__wf_reserved_inherit

The first mistake is to believe that the tool determines the direction, when in fact it is merely a driver. This is one of the most common AI pricing mistakes.

Symptoms: opportunistic decisions, lack of goals, lack of segmentation

Price changes are often observed that lack any overarching logic. The absence of clear segmentation leads to erratic pricing that confuses loyal customers and partners.

Management is based on visual assessment. There are no specific targets.

Risks: inconsistency, loss of profit margin, price war

The danger is accidentally triggering a destructive price war. Price inconsistencies across sales channels ultimately erode gross margins irreversibly.

The brand's reputation suffers. Customers lose confidence.

How to avoid: targets, segmentation, discount policies, price corridors

Set minimum and maximum price ranges to guide the algorithm. Establish a strict discount policy and segment your customers based on their actual value rather than their volume.

A human must validate the thresholds. The strategy dictates the tool.

Mistake #2 — Using incomplete, dirty, or ungoverned data

__wf_reserved_inherit

If you feed the AI junk data, don’t be surprised if it gives you toxic advice for your business.

Symptoms: inconsistent recommendations, unstable results

The recommendations vary wildly for no apparent reason. There are glaring inconsistencies between similar products, indicating that the source data is contaminated by data entry errors.

The models lose all stability. The predictions become unusable.

Risks: poor pricing, loss of team confidence

A poor price can drive away your best customers. Worse still, your sales teams may reject the tool altogether if they consider its pricing to be unreasonable.

The rollout comes to a sudden halt. The investment is completely lost.

How to avoid: data readiness, data dictionary, ownership, quality

Create a data dictionary to standardize definitions. Appoint quality assurance leads and ensure that data flows are regularly audited before feeding them into your models.

60 %

AI projects will be abandoned by 2026 due to a lack of AI-ready data (Gartner, February 2025).

Mistake No. 3 — Over-automating without safeguards ("free-wheeling" pricing)

Full automation is a dangerous fantasy that can turn your catalog into an algorithmic battlefield.

Symptoms: too frequent changes, uncontrolled exceptions

Prices fluctuate several times a day without any market justification. These AI-driven pricing errors generate a growing number of exceptions in an opaque manner, making it impossible for management to assess sales performance.

The system is stuck in a loop. No one understands the fluctuations.

Risks: brand image, pricing, margins, customer experience, operational chaos

Customers feel cheated by excessive volatility. This creates internal chaos, with salespeople spending their time justifying prices they don't even understand themselves.

The margin is quietly disappearing. The shopping experience is deteriorating.

1 in 4

This is the number of U.S. customers who encounter a pricing error at the register at least once a month, according to a survey of 2,011 consumers (University at Buffalo, Center for Marketing Analysis, 2025).

How to avoid: min/max ranges, thresholds, exception rules, validations

Set strict limits that the AI must never cross. Set up automatic alerts whenever a recommendation strays from the norm, requiring immediate human approval.

Use simple rulers to frame the machine. Here are the supports you need to install:

  • Tight price ranges.
  • Automatic alert thresholds.
  • Human verification is required for large accounts.

Keep the final say. The machine suggests, the human decides.

Mistake #4 — Treating a recommendation as a decision (without assessing its impact)

Blindly following what the AI says is like driving with your eyes closed on a mountain road. It’s one of the most dangerous mistakes in AI pricing.

Symptoms: no testing, no monitoring, no rollback

The new prices are being rolled out on a massive scale without any prior testing. There is no procedure in place to quickly reverse the changes if sales figures suddenly take a nosedive.

We're sailing without a map. Unfortunately, the actual impact remains unknown.

Risks: Hidden Negative Effects (Volume, Churn, Margin)

You could lose sales volume without realizing it right away. The churn rate could skyrocket if the AI misjudges your customers' price sensitivity.

Financial damage often goes unnoticed. By the time it becomes apparent, it’s already too late.

How to avoid: A/B testing or pilot studies, monitoring KPIs, review committee

Always test on a small scale before rolling out the changes. Convene a weekly review committee to analyze key performance indicators and adjust the models based on feedback from the field.

Caution is the key to profitability. Always take things one step at a time.

Mistake #5 — Overlooking risks (privacy, compliance, competition, bias)

AI is not a lawless zone; ignoring these threats is one of the worst mistakes in AI pricing.

Symptoms: sharing of sensitive data, uncontrolled access

Confidential data ends up in open models. Access to tools is not restricted: anyone can modify strategic margins.

Safety is being neglected. It's dangerous.

Risks: data breaches, non-compliance, biased decisions

A data breach undermines your competitive advantage. Biased algorithms expose you to heavy penalties for illegal price discrimination.

Your reputation is on the line. Fines are lurking.

51

Bills regulating algorithmic pricing were introduced in 24 U.S. states during the first seven months of 2025, compared with 10 in all of 2024 (Consumer Reports, July 2025).

How to prevent this: access control, anonymization, audit trail, usage policies

Traceability of decisions is a lifeline for your pricing strategy when dealing with regulators.

Anonymize the data. Implement a comprehensive audit trail to track every price change and ensure compliance.

Secure your expertise. Technical rigor prevents disasters.

Essential safeguards for AI-powered pricing

To ensure peace of mind and avoid costly AI pricing errors, your system must incorporate native, tamper-proof security measures.

Price corridors, discount rules, multi-level approvals

Price corridors contain the algorithm's deviations. Require human approval for any out-of-range discounts to prevent margin erosion. It's your safety net.

The framework remains rigid. The AI operates solely within these strict boundaries.

Audit trail: who decided what and why

Every price change requires an indelible digital record. Always document the reason behind each decision so you can analyze your futuresuccesses or failures. You can't manage what you don't know.

Your history becomes your greatest asset. Never underestimate the power of logs.

Monitoring: margin, discount leakage, win rate, churn, perceived price

Track discount leakage to stop the drain on your profits. Analyze the win rate in real time to adjust the sensitivity of your models to sudden market reactions.

The data never lies. Keep your eyes on this dashboard.

"Safe" and Useful AI Use Cases for a Pricing Team

There’s no need to revolutionize everything all at once; start with quick wins that don’t involve any major risks.

Summary and organization: policies, arguments, rules

Use AI to draft your pricing policies and sales pitches. It organizes your internal guidelines in a consistent manner, making it easier for all sales teams to adopt them.

It saves a tremendous amount of time. It makes things much clearer.

Anomaly detection: unusual discounts, inconsistent prices

The algorithm instantly detects unusual discounts. It identifies inconsistent prices in your catalog, allowing you to correct AI-driven pricing errors before they impact your annual financial results.

It's an effective safety net. Mistakes are quickly corrected.

Simulation: margin/volume impact, scenarios, sensitivity

Simulate the impact of a price increase on your overall sales volume. Test different sensitivity scenarios to anticipate competitors’ reactions and protect your net margins.

Plan for the future without risk. Simulation is a powerful tool.

Workflows: Speed Up Approvals Without Losing Control

Automate the special offer approval process. AI filters out simple requests and forwards only complex cases to experts, thereby accelerating the company’s sales responsiveness.

Business moves faster. Control remains complete.

30-Day Rollout Plan (Simple and Realistic)

Here’s a practical, four-step weekly plan to transform your pricing strategy and avoid common AI pricing mistakes.

Week 1: Choose 1 use case, define the baseline and KPIs

Start by identifying a single priority pricing issue. Establish your current baseline based on historical performance. Select key performance indicators to measure the immediate financial impact.

Avoid spreading yourself too thin. A clear vision ensures success.

Week 2: Securing Data and Rules (Guardrails)

Filter the data specifically required for this use case. Set up technical safeguards to prevent any inconsistent price quotes. Enforce strict rules to mitigate major financial risks.

Secure your system now. Security comes first.

Week 3: Pilot program on a limited scale + adjustments

Launch the pilot program on a limited range of products. Analyze daily results to identify anomalies. Adjust the algorithm’s parameters based on real-world feedback.

Learn by moving quickly. Agility determines the project's viability.

Week 4: Formalize processes, training, go/no-go decision

Document each step to ensure the process is reproducible. Train your teams on the new pricing tools. Approve the full rollout only based on solid, quantifiable evidence.

Make the change in methodology official. The implementation will then proceed smoothly.

A transition becomes necessary when Excel files become too cumbersome to maintain, too slow to use, or a source of recurring errors that directly affect the prices displayed.

The clearest indicator, as discussed in this article regarding data quality: if your teams spend more time consolidating data than managing pricing strategy, the investment in migrating to a dedicated pricing solution is already justified. A spreadsheet has no built-in safeguards, no audit trail, and no automated price corridors.

Dedicated pricing software enables the standardization of business rules —price ranges, discount policies, and multi-level validations—and enhances the reliability of processes that neither the volume nor the complexity of Excel can handle anymore.

It is also a prerequisite for effective governance: without reliable traceability of pricing decisions, it becomes impossible to document who approved what, or to respond confidently to a regulator or an internal audit.
